Biography

Mahmoud Ibrahim is a Research Assistant at the Institute of Evolutionary Medicine at the University of Zurich. He specializes in Evolutionary Pathophysiology and Mummy Studies. His academic background includes a Master's degree in Egyptology. He is actively engaged in research that integrates evolutionary biology with medical science, focusing on the analysis of ancient human remains to understand health and disease in historical contexts. His work contributes to the understanding of the biological and cultural factors that influence health outcomes in different populations, particularly in ancient Egypt. With a keen interest in interdisciplinary approaches, Mahmoud collaborates with experts in various fields to advance research in his area of expertise.
